The books
Seven books, one argument
- Book One
The Platform Premium
Available nowA private-equity-backed logistics company must decide what to build, what to buy and what operational judgment cannot be outsourced.
- Book Two
The Industry Premium
Available nowAn insurer discovers that its product is not the policy it sold, but the promise it must keep when paying becomes expensive.

These are novels, not textbooks.
Each book places a management idea inside a consequential decision. The characters must choose before they have complete information, and somebody must carry the cost when the choice is wrong.
